An LDA Texas Program in Partnership with EPTSA
LDA Texas invites parents, educators, advocates, professionals, and community members to join us for a three-part virtual book study featuring Raising An Anxious Child: A Parent and Educator’s Perspective by Rachel Krueger and Beverley H. Johns.
This book study series will provide a thoughtful opportunity to discuss childhood anxiety from both a parent and educator perspective. Together, we will explore ways to better understand, support, and encourage children who experience anxiety at home, at school, and in the community.
Book Study Dates
Session 1: Friday, July 10, 2026
Session 2: Friday, July 24, 2026
Session 3: Friday, August 7, 2026
Time: 12:00 PM
Location: Virtual via Zoom
